In Milan conference on "Ethics, Business & Finance"

Ethics and Finance. Two worlds often considered distant, sometimes in antithesis. Yet never before has the need to reconcile moral values ​​and economic-financial interests been indispensable as in this time. What is the real possibility of bringing the economy, finance and business management back to a human and social dimension? It is being discussed today in Milan in a round table entitled "Ethics, Business & Finance", at the Events Space of the Swiss Chamber of Commerce in Italy, starting at 15.00 pm. 

The conference aims to compare these apparently distant worlds which are nonetheless required to confront each other and question themselves on how to balance moral values ​​and economic interest, declining the challenge from the point of view of professionals. The objective is to formulate open questions on what the future of financial ethics and ethical business management is, on how these aspects can be integrated into the training and practice of professionals, leaving it up to the sensitivity and experience of each operator, with their own peculiarities and problems, to provide their own answer or indication. 

Speakers include the lawyer Valeria Ruoppolo, Professor Luciano Hinna, Full Professor of Economics of Public Companies Department of Law University of Rome "Tor Vergata", Elena Bonanni, economic-financial journalist who collaborates with FIRSTtonline and co-founder of EticaNews, Luca Testoni, co-founder and director ETicaNews, author of the book La Legge degli Affari, Lawyer Isabella Lavezzari, president of AGAM – AIGA Milan, Massimo Bortolin, secretary of the Register Commission of ODCEC Milan and Arrigo Roveda, president of the Notary Council of Milan. The Order of Accountants and Accounting Experts and the Order of Lawyers of Milan recognize 3 professional training credits to participants in the event.
